- When eating with chopsticks, POSITION one chopstick between
- thumb and index finger, supporting it on the ring finger and holding
- it like a pencil. This chopstick will be stationary. HOLD the other
- chopstick with the tips of thumb, index, and middle fingers - this
- one will move. MOVE the top chopstick up and down with your thumb and first finger.

- To eat sushi, GRASP it by placing one chopstick on either side of the
- rice and fish. TURN the Sushi piece on its side, to ensure the rice does
- not crumble. DIP one corner of the fish topping, "tane," into the soy
- sauce and place the sushi in your mouth with the tane down, so that
- it is the first part to hit your tongue. This is considered the correct
- way to enjoy the taste of the sushi. It is common to dip the rice
- instead of the fish in the soy sauce. This should be avoided, however,
- as it makes the rice patty crumble, and the soy sauce overpowers the
- subtle taste of the vinegared rice.
